A Lithuanian startup has launched an open-source network that uses volunteers’ smartphones to detect Shahed-type drones, marking a significant step in civilian-led drone monitoring efforts in the Baltic region.

The initiative, led by the Mainline startup and supported by local security and technology partners, involves volunteers connecting unused Android smartphones near windows. The devices run an app that continuously analyzes ambient sounds for low-frequency signatures characteristic of Shahed drone engines. When multiple devices detect the same acoustic signature, the system can estimate the drone’s location, providing a real-time map of drone activity.

The project currently involves about 20 specialists and aims to recruit 10,000 active users across Lithuania, the Baltic states, and Poland. Future plans include integrating audio from residents’ surveillance cameras and potentially installing sensors on telecommunications towers through partnerships with mobile network operators. The team emphasizes privacy, aiming to identify drones with minimal data collection.

Potential Impact on Regional Drone Security

This open-source network introduces a community-driven approach to drone detection, potentially enhancing security in the Baltic region by providing real-time, civilian-sourced intelligence. If successful, it could serve as a model for other areas facing drone-related threats, especially in conflict or sensitive zones. Additionally, the project demonstrates how civilian participation and open technology can complement official security measures, fostering resilience and community engagement.

Background of Civilian Drone Monitoring Initiatives

Recent years have seen increased concern over the use of drones, particularly Shahed-type models, in regional conflicts and security threats. Governments and security agencies have explored various detection methods, including radar and surveillance cameras. However, civilian-led, open-source solutions like this Lithuanian project represent a novel approach, leveraging widespread smartphone adoption and community participation. The initiative aligns with broader trends toward civic resilience and decentralized security efforts in the Baltic region and beyond.

Unconfirmed Aspects of System Effectiveness and Privacy

It is not yet clear how accurately the system can detect and locate drones in diverse environments or how effectively it can differentiate drone sounds from other low-frequency noises. Additionally, while privacy is emphasized, the specifics of data handling and user anonymity remain to be clarified as the project develops.

Upcoming Deployment and Expansion Plans

The team plans to expand participation to reach 10,000 active users, increase geographic coverage across the Baltic states and Poland, and incorporate additional sensors like surveillance cameras and telecom towers. They also aim to establish partnerships with mobile network operators to enhance detection capabilities and refine the system’s accuracy through ongoing testing and user feedback.

Key Questions

How does the drone detection system work?

The system relies on volunteers’ smartphones running an app that analyzes ambient sounds for low-frequency signatures characteristic of Shahed drones. When multiple devices detect the same sound, the system estimates the drone’s location and displays it on a real-time map.

Is user privacy protected in this system?

Yes, the developers emphasize that privacy remains a priority, aiming to identify drones with minimal data collection and ensuring that personal information is not compromised.

Can this system detect all drone types?

The current focus is on Shahed-type drones, which have distinctive acoustic signatures. Its effectiveness against other drone models has not yet been confirmed.

Will the system be available outside Lithuania?

The project aims to expand across the Baltic region and Poland, with plans to involve more participants and integrate additional sensors in the future.

What are the technical challenges of this approach?

Challenges include accurately distinguishing drone sounds from ambient noise, ensuring reliable detection in various environments, and maintaining user privacy while collecting useful data.
